About the Training Program
Miller's offers free training for those interested in becoming a Certified Nursing Assistant. The program includes both classroom instruction and clinical training. Upon completion, students must pass the state exam to become a Certified Nurse's Aide.
Qualifications
- Pass a criminal background check, TB test, and physical prior to starting the course.
- Mandatory attendance to all classroom sessions to meet program requirements set by the Indiana State Department of Health.
Classroom Instruction
- Complete 36-40 hours of classroom work.
- Pass all tests administered during the classroom portion with a score of 80% or higher (3 attempts allowed).
- Failure to pass the classroom phase will disqualify the student from proceeding to clinicals.
Clinical Practicum
- Complete 75 hours of supervised practicum in a long-term care facility, performing all required skills successfully.
- The first 16 hours of practicum are with the class instructor; absence during this time results in dismissal from the program.
- Students may be assigned a preceptor to assist with organization and time management.
- At completion, both the preceptor and instructor will evaluate the student’s progress.
- All skills checklists (RCPs) not signed during classroom instruction must be demonstrated and signed off during clinicals by the clinical instructor or another licensed nursing professional.
- Students must submit a completed checklist (RCP) with all required skills signed off to be eligible for the state exam.
- Maintain a daily "clinical sign-in record" with the date, actual hours worked, student signature, and co-signature of a licensed supervisor.
Additional Information
- Unsatisfactory performance or attendance issues may result in dismissal from the program.
- Students should check with the facility for dress code requirements.
- Upon successful completion, students receive a certificate of completion and a scheduled test date.
- If hired and in good standing as an employee, Miller’s Merry Manor will pay for the state exam. A second attempt is also covered if needed.
- Non-employees must schedule and pay for their own exam.
